The owners are from Northern Italy and the name comes from the famous Venetian palace.
- It's trying to maintain its original European atmosphere but in some instances has
submitted to more modern aspects.
- Excellent restaurant, International cooking and Italian specialities. One of the best,
if not the best, is the Bollito Misto accompanied by Mostarda di Cremona. This a delicious variety of boiled meats carved and served at the table, plus vegetables and the Cremona Mustard (which has almost nothing related to our common mustard) a hot condiment/dressing.
- The installations and facilities make it such that one can spend quite a few days there without needing to go out.

I wondered where the taxi was taking me on my way from the airport to the hotel. The area seemed to get worse as we went on and I was really surprised when I saw the hotel. The entrance on the website looks very impressive, the reality is very different( see photo).
The location of the hotel wasn?t what I expected, and it seemed to be very run down and seedy, definitely not a tourist area. There were large open rubbish bins in the street, sometimes overflowing and surrounded by rubbish. Filthy pavements, when you could walk on them and they weren?t being used for parked cars. There were a few supermarkets, a bakery and a take away pizza place, but hardly any cafes nearby. There was traffic noise during the morning and evening rush hours.
